Position Summary:
This person will be a member of the Recovery team of WestCare Tennessee and will primarily be responsible for working collaboratively with the Treatment Counselor, Supportive Employment Coach and Peer Support Specialist in the Supportive Employment grant. The Case Manager will provide services to individuals and meet the needs of the individual to determine appropriate referrals.
Essential Job Functions:
Embrace and embody the mission, vision, guiding principles, clinical vision and goals of WestCare Tennessee.
Deliver evidence-based curriculum to individuals in a group setting.
Educate and refer individuals to community agencies and businesses that appropriately address the individual needs for food, shelter, clothing, employment, transportation, and other community resources.
Assist individuals with establishing or re-establishing support systems within their community.
Advocate on behalf of the individual in order for them to receive access to needed services in addressing appropriate needs.
Participate in staffing decisions regarding individuals’ current enrollment status in order to help them to meet the goals of their Individual Service Plan (ISP) and treatment plan.
Complete documentation of services on provided forms promptly.
Provide input to the Treatment Counselor regarding the individual treatment needs which may include conducting discharges, incident reports, and other related documentation.
Perform individual follow up interviews to document individual progress, to make additional referrals if needed and to maintain active communication throughout the duration of their enrollment in the program.
Will engage and complete the required WestCare Tennessee eLearning, and any other program related trainings.
